Love Our Schools Day

Become a Part of Love Our Schools Day 2026

Are you a local school with a project? Love Our Schools Day is a project-based volunteer day when the community can roll up their sleeves at a local school and make a difference where it is needed most whether it is planting a garden, painting a classroom, or fixing up a playground.
